If you'd like to get involved with this year's fire festival in the west of the Island, you're being invited to an event this weekend.
The Oie Voaldyn Festival is held in Peel each May to mark the change from winter to summer.
Organisers say they're looking for more people to get involved with the event, whether volunteering on the day or helping to set it up.
They'll be hosting a meeting at Peel Masonic Hall on Stanley Road from 2pm on Sunday, February 22.
